Understanding PainkillersPainkillers, or analgesics, are medications developed to ease pain. They can be categorized into two primary classifications: over-the-counter (OTC) and prescription medications.
Kinds of Painkillers
TypeExamplesCommon UsesOver-the-Counter (OTC)Acetaminophen, IbuprofenModerate to moderate pain reliefPrescriptionOpioids (e.g., Oxycodone), NSAIDs (e.g., Ketorolac)Severe pain, post-operative pain, persistent conditionsOver-the-Counter Painkillers
OTC painkillers are widely offered at drug stores, supermarkets, and convenience stores without a prescription. They are frequently utilized for:
- Headaches
- Muscle pains
- Joint pain
- Fever decrease
Some popular OTC painkillers include:
- Acetaminophen (Tylenol): Effective for mild to moderate pain and fever.
- Ibuprofen (Advil, Motrin): A non-steroidal anti-inflammatory drug (NSAID) that minimizes swelling, pain, and fever.
- Aspirin: An effective painkiller and anti-inflammatory agent however need to be utilized with caution due to prospective intestinal negative effects.
Prescription Painkillers
Prescription painkillers are more powerful medications that are usually utilized for more severe pain. They require a healthcare company's authorization and include:
- Opioids: Such as morphine, hydrocodone, and oxycodone. Reliable for sharp pain however bring a risk of dependence and overdose.
- NSAIDs: Higher dosages of NSAIDs can likewise be prescribed for swelling and pain management in conditions like arthritis.

Q1: Are all painkillers safe?
Not all painkillers are safe for everybody. People with particular medical conditions, allergic reactions, or those taking other medications need to consult a doctor to examine security.
Q2: Can I take OTC painkillers with prescription medications?
It's important to speak with a health care supplier before integrating OTC painkillers with prescription drugs, as interactions can take place.
Q3: How do I know if I need a prescription painkiller?
If OTC medications are ineffective for managing pain or if the pain is serious, a doctor may recommend a prescription painkiller.
Q4: What should I do if I experience negative effects?
If adverse effects take place, it's vital to stop taking the medication and speak with a health care service provider right away.
Q5: Why are some painkillers managed more strictly than others?
Particular painkillers, especially opioids, have a high capacity for abuse and reliance. Therefore, Diätmedikamente are regulated more strictly to avoid misuse and safeguard public health.
